BIOCHEMICAL ACTIVITY AND FUNCTIONAL-STRUCTURAL PECULIARITIES OF MICROBIOCENOSIS OF TYPICAL CHERNOZEM SOILS CONTAMINATED OF HEAVY METALS

Full Text:

Abstract

This paper highlights researching of restructuring of microbiocenosis and levels biochemical activity of chernozem belt with contamination of heavy metals and melioration Trihodermini. The influence of pollution on microbiocenose soil in specification of heavy metal. A soil microflora of a typical mushroom culture of Trihodermini greatly enhances the transformation of soil organic matter as without pollution and with the aftereffect of heavy metals.
